Back on topic regards stuff not working, i've had my 300 6 years and the cruise control never worked, i'd checked all the diags and relays to no avail, then when groover did my LED conversion i got a better condition right side pod and it worked, it was the pod all along, must have been a faulty switch. Don't you just love free fixes.

All depends what your budget is really, i had my 200sx S14a for nearly 5 years and spent very little on it probably around a grand for services and maintenance, a 300zx is a lot more expensive to run imo, and more prone to go wrong due to age and complexity of them. They are both very nice cars to drive but the 200sx is definately more agile due to weight and seems more a buzzy turbo car whereas the 300zx is a brute of car and is great in a straight line but unless you have a fairly good suspension setup ie lots of new parts as these are old cars it is not a twisty b road car. So if you want some fun in a nice handling car get a 200sx s14a if you want grunt and looks get the 300zx.
  9. I've just had mine done with r134a, they put a new connector on sucked the old out, dropped in a can of r12 > r134a this contains the necessary oils, they did this using the high pressure line but put a low pressure connector on as thats what the can uses. Seems fine much colder than before.
